Emotions were high Wednesday evening near the scene of a fatal shooting at a convenience store in Donora.

Washington County Coroner S. Timothy Warco identified the victim as 28-year-old Nicholas Tarpley of Donora.

Warco said Tarpley was part-owner of Anna Lee’s Convenience Store at 501 Allen Ave., which is the site of the shooting.

A large presence of state troopers and Donora police were on scene outside of the store at the intersection of Fifth Street and Allen Avenue. A large group of the victim’s family members and friends stood across the street waiting to hear from those investigators while  consoling one another.

The family members, who didn’t want to share their names, through tears said the victim was a good person.

“He didn’t deserve this,” one of the victim’s female relatives said.
